摘要
目的 研究肾上腺素、异丙肾上腺素及三磷酸腺苷对大鼠心肌细胞阴离子交换蛋白Cl-/HCO-3 交换活性的影响 ,探讨其病理生理意义。方法 计算机辅助微量荧光检测法测定培养的正常及心衰心肌细胞Cl-/HCO-3 交换活性。结果 心衰心肌细胞pHi的恢复斜率大于正常心肌细胞 ,肾上腺素、异丙肾上腺素及三磷酸腺苷对碱负载的正常及心衰心肌细胞pHi的恢复斜率均分别显著大于对照。结论 心衰心肌细胞Cl-/HCO-3 交换活性大于正常心肌细胞 ,肾上腺素、异丙肾上腺素及三磷酸腺苷增强了正常及心衰心肌细胞Cl-/HCO-3
Objective To study the intensifying effect of adrenaline, isoprenaline and ATP on the exchanging activity of Cl -/HCO - 3 of the anion exchanger of rat cardiomyocytes and its pathophysiological significance. Methods The exchanging activity of Cl -/HCO - 3 of the anion exchanger was examined with computer assisted microfluorescence technique. Results The recovery rate of pHi from base loading was larger in the myocardial cells in congestive heart failure (CHF) than in normal cardiac myocytes. After the treatment of adrenaline, isoprenaline and ATP, the recovery rate of pHi from base loading was larger in the normal cardiomyocytes and the myocardial cells in CHF than in the control without the treatment of 3 agents. Conclusion The exchanging activity of Cl -/HCO - 3 is larger in the myocardial cells in CHF than in normal cardiomyocytes. The administration of adrenaline, isoprenaline and ATP can intensity the exchanging activity of Cl -/HCO - 3 in both normal and diseased cardiac myocytes.
